Admittedly, I am not an artist, so this is a generic review as opposed to an expert review. I like these a lot, purchased them for my grandchildren and use them myself often.
I got them from Michael's (craft store), and while standing in the aisle, looked up reviews of the different watercolor crayon products offered. Some of them had terrible reviews, but these had a really good review (probably on the Amazon.com website). So I chose these.
All I can verify is that they work, and the way I actually prefer to use them is to dip the end of the crayon in water and then color/paint with it. It is easier than first coloring and then applying water with a wet paintbrush, or first painting the paper with a wet paintbrush and then coloring on the wet paper. Little kids cannot easily control the amount of water in their paintbrush, so water can pool on the paper and you can still have a mess, but if the tip is dipped in water, it just softens the paint and doesn't make a watery mess on the paper.
Now I want a larger set. Watercolor pencils are nice, too. They work better for coloring more intricate patterns.
